Float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
When was Float founded?
Float was founded in 2021.
Where is Float's headquarters?
Float's headquarters is located at Honolulu.
What is Float's latest funding round?
Float's latest funding round is Seed VC.
How much did Float raise?
Float raised a total of $130K.
Who are the investors of Float?
Investors of Float include Y Combinator and Liquid 2 Ventures.
Who are Float's competitors?
Competitors of Float include Capchase and 1 more.

Pipe provides financial services specializing in non-dilutive capital solutions for businesses. It offers a modern capital platform that allows entrepreneurs to access funding based on their revenue, with payment terms. It primarily serves the financial needs of small to mid-size businesses and entrepreneurs seeking growth without equity dilution. It was formerly known as Third Base Pipe. The company was founded in 2019 and is based in San Francisco, California.
Founderpath is a financial services company that operates in the Software as a Service (SaaS) industry. The company provides funding solutions for SaaS founders, offering services that allow them to track customer and business metrics, get their business valuation, and secure capital without selling equity. Primarily, Founderpath caters to the needs of the SaaS industry. Founderpath was formerly known as Operation Pie. It was founded in 2019 and is based in Austin, Texas.
SaaS Capital is a provider of debt-based growth capital for SaaS companies. By leveraging the predictable revenue streams of the SaaS business model, SaaS Capital allows companies to use debt instead of equity to fund investments in sales, marketing, and new product development. SaaS Capital's line of credit approach combines more availability and longer terms, with more flexible drawdown and repayment, versus other lenders in the market. Through its partnership with DH Capital, SaaS Capital can also assist with a variety of M&A and capital raising advisory services.

Clearco specializes in providing working capital to the ecommerce sector, focusing on funding invoices and receipts for businesses. The company offers a rapid funding process that allows ecommerce businesses to receive capital in as little as 24 hours without the need for collateral, personal guarantees, or equity dilution. Clearco's services are designed to help ecommerce businesses manage cash flow and invest in growth by funding operational expenses such as inventory, marketing, and logistics. Clearco was formerly known as Clearbanc. It was founded in 2015 and is based in Toronto, Ontario.

Lighter Capital is a fintech company focused on the business of startup finance. The firm provides tech entrepreneurs up to $2M in capital to grow their startups while retaining equity and control. Its application and underwriting processes are powered by proprietary technology that lets entrepreneurs spend less time fundraising and more time building their businesses. Based in Seattle, Lighter Capital invests in companies across the US.

Levenue is a platform focused on providing financial services in the business sector. The company offers a service that allows businesses with recurring revenue to access funding without dilution of shares. It primarily serves businesses in need of non-dilutive financing to accelerate their growth. It was founded in 2021 and is based in Breda, Netherlands.
